Wupatki National MonumentDiscover the ancient legacy of the Sinagua people at Wupatki National Monument, where stunning red-rock outcroppings dot the prairie landscape. Visit the impressive Wupatki pueblo, meaning "Tall House" in Hopi, featuring over 100 rooms and a community space. Marvel at the remarkably preserved walls, constructed from local Moenkopi sandstone and mortar. Explore the northernmost ballcourt in North America and uncover the secrets of this ancient civilization. Experience the rich history and breathtaking scenery of this unique archaeological site.

Sunset Crater Volcano National MonumentVisit the stunning Sunset Crater Volcano National Monument, a protected area featuring a unique cinder cone within the San Francisco Volcanic Field. Learn about the monument's fascinating history, including its preservation after a public outcry saved it from potential destruction in the 1920s. Take a self-guided loop trail around the base of the volcano and explore the visitor centre to discover more about this natural wonder

Museum of Northern ArizonaVisit the Museum of Northern Arizona, a historic institution founded in 1928 by Harold S. Colton and Mary-Russell Ferrell Colton. Explore the region's natural and cultural heritage through research, collections, conservation, and education. The museum features rotating exhibitions on various subjects, showcasing the unique history and beauty of the Colorado Plateau. As an accredited member of the American Alliance of Museums, it's a must-visit destination for anyone interested in the region's rich heritage

Walnut Canyon National MonumentDiscover the breathtaking beauty of Walnut Canyon, a stunning gorge carved by the Walnut Creek, featuring numerous cliff dwellings and ancient ruins of the Sinagua people. This national monument offers a glimpse into the lives of the ancient inhabitants of the region, with well-preserved ruins and stunning red rock formations. Take a scenic hike down into the canyon or explore the rim trail, and experience the unique natural and cultural heritage of this Arizona wonder
